One must be "PC", as in the equally curious coinage of "Mumbai" for a city founded by the Portuguese and named "Bom Baia"!

Seriously, my dictionary of PNG Pidgin spells it thus. I believe that a true pidgin uses the grammar of one language with the vocabulary of at least one other language, so China Coast Pidgin used Chinese grammar and English and Portuguese words.
